Indication & Scope
XuanFeiNing® Dirozalkib Tablets treats adult patients with locally advanced or metastatic non-small cell lung cancer confirmed with ALK gene rearrangement, who have not received prior ALK inhibitor treatment.
- Mechanism: Dirozalkib is a selective small-molecule tyrosine kinase inhibitor that covalently binds to the kinase domain of anaplastic lymphoma kinase (ALK). It blocks downstream ALK-mediated cell proliferation signaling pathways, induces tumor cell cycle arrest and apoptosis, and inhibits tumor growth in ALK-rearranged lung cancer lesions.
- Drug class: Antineoplastic agent; ALK tyrosine kinase inhibitor (oral targeted anti-cancer drug).
- Clinical use: First-line monotherapy for unresectable ALK-positive locally advanced or metastatic NSCLC; provides durable disease control and intracranial anti-tumor activity for patients with brain metastases.

How to use ?
Recommended Dose: 300 mg orally once daily for adult patients. Adjust dose to 200 mg or suspend administration upon grade 3 or higher adverse toxicities.
Time: Take at a fixed time every 24 hours, with or without food. If a dose is missed for more than 6 hours, skip the missed dose and resume regular dosing the next day; do not take double doses.
Instructions for use: Swallow tablets whole with plain water; do not crush, split or chew tablets. Standard laboratory monitoring of liver function, blood routine and ECG is required before initiation and every 2 weeks during the first treatment month.
Interaction: Strong CYP3A4 inhibitors (ketoconazole, clarithromycin) increase systemic exposure of dirozalkib, requiring dose reduction; strong CYP3A4 inducers (rifampicin, phenytoin) significantly reduce drug efficacy and should be avoided.
Side effects:
1. Common adverse reactions: elevated liver transaminases, diarrhea, fatigue, visual disturbance, peripheral edema.
2. Severe rare side effects: interstitial lung disease, severe QT interval prolongation, severe neutropenia.
